Campbell College Junior School was officially opened on Friday 15 September by Sir John and Lady MacDermott.
The MacDermott family’s connection with the College spans over 100 years; four generations of the family either served on the Board of Governors or presided over the Old Campbellian society. Indeed, the MacDermott Wing was named after Sir John’s father, Lord Mac Dermott, in recognition of 25 years of service to the Board.
The newly built Junior School has been described as a “quantum leap forward” in design and in the provision of environmentally friendly accommodation. The School features state-of-the-art ventilation, insulation, heating and acoustic systems; the new school stands as a practical example of what it means to be energy efficient.
The official opening celebrations included the Board of Governors, Junior School staff and parents as well as the 146 children from Kindergarten - Prep 7.
